New to DW and Me 5er
2 days short of 1 year since I joined IRV2 and I have to report that we finally purchased our first 5th wheel.
It's not a new one or an elite model, but, it fits our needs and we are happy with our choice.
1989 Terry Resort 25 5L
A relative told me about this 5er in great condition for it's age. He talked so good about it that I had to check it out. I looked online for pictures of a similar trailer. Pictures looked nice.
I called the Seller and drove 40 miles up the hill to take a look. It looked really nice. It was better than I was expecting. Speaking to the Seller, he sounded genuinely honest and I didn't get the feeling he was misrepresenting information. I now wanted it.
Since it was Sunday, I couldn't get the money for the purchase so I gave him a check for the deposit until I could get the money, during the week. I didn't even have the hitch installed, yet. I started researching here for info and received a lot of advice. Thanks everyone.
I scheduled the hitch install for Friday. After installation, I picked up the 5er and drove it up and down the hill with no issues with towing. This was last weekend.
It had rained pretty good since, and I didn't find any signs of leaks or stains.
2 days ago, I registered it.
Yesterday, I went through the operations and details of electrical (120v and battery power; there is a compartment for a generator, but not present); the propane ( tanks, leaks, pilot lights, and burners); and water pump, tank, & plumbing.
